The Dow Jones is primarily industrial stocks.  The NasDaq primarily Technology Stocks.  For a more generalized market you need to look at the S&P 500.

Everybody knows that was the "Tech Bubble" that was supported by hundreds of millions in venture capital and very few of the companies actually had a viable business model on how they were going to make money once the venture capital evaporated.  Everybody also knows who survived: Amazon, Ebay, and a few others.  In 1998-99 there were literally hundreds if not thousands of similar services.  I remember that there was an online grocery store, a grocery store for crying out loud!
